What is a remote game audio professional?
Career: Remote Game Audio
A Remote Game Audio professional is someone who specializes in creating, editing, and implementing sound effects, music, and voiceovers for video games while working from a remote location. They collaborate with game developers and other creative teams online to ensure the audio enhances the gaming experience. Their responsibilities can include sound design, audio engineering, dialogue editing, and integrating audio assets using game development tools. Remote positions allow these professionals to work for studios around the world without needing to relocate. This flexibility has become increasingly common in the game industry.
